Bugzilla – Attachment 22139 Details for
Bug 10493
Add renewal script
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Help
|
New Account
|
Log In
[x]
|
Forgot Password
Login:
[x]
[patch]
Bug 10493 [QA follow-up] Add renewal script
Bug-10493-QA-follow-up-Add-renewal-script.patch (text/plain), 4.73 KB, created by
Kyle M Hall (khall)
on 2013-10-20 23:54:57 UTC
(
hide
)
Description:
Bug 10493 [QA follow-up] Add renewal script
Filename:
MIME Type:
Creator:
Kyle M Hall (khall)
Created:
2013-10-20 23:54:57 UTC
Size:
4.73 KB
patch
obsolete
>From f9223f70de4c65c9d63194739ee2f9f4633ee1f4 Mon Sep 17 00:00:00 2001 >From: Kyle M Hall <kyle@bywatersolutions.com> >Date: Sun, 20 Oct 2013 19:04:35 -0400 >Subject: [PATCH] Bug 10493 [QA follow-up] Add renewal script > >--- > Koha/Template/Plugin/Koha.pm | 6 ++++++ > circ/renew.pl | 2 +- > .../intranet-tmpl/prog/en/modules/circ/renew.tt | 7 +++---- > 3 files changed, 10 insertions(+), 5 deletions(-) > >diff --git a/Koha/Template/Plugin/Koha.pm b/Koha/Template/Plugin/Koha.pm >index 2eff9f1..bdc715e 100644 >--- a/Koha/Template/Plugin/Koha.pm >+++ b/Koha/Template/Plugin/Koha.pm >@@ -20,6 +20,7 @@ package Koha::Template::Plugin::Koha; > use Modern::Perl; > > use base qw( Template::Plugin ); >+use Encode qw{encode decode}; > > use C4::Context; > >@@ -44,4 +45,9 @@ sub Preference { > return C4::Context->preference( $pref ); > } > >+sub Encode { >+ my ( $self, $value ) = @_; >+ return encode( 'UTF-8', $value ); >+} >+ > 1; >diff --git a/circ/renew.pl b/circ/renew.pl >index 6634c0c..5085a00 100755 >--- a/circ/renew.pl >+++ b/circ/renew.pl >@@ -6,7 +6,7 @@ > # > # Koha is free software; you can redistribute it and/or modify it under the > # terms of the GNU General Public License as published by the Free Software >-# Foundation; either version 2 of the License, or (at your option) any later >+# Foundation; either version 3 of the License, or (at your option) any later > # version. > # > # Koha is distributed in the hope that it will be useful, but WITHOUT ANY >diff --git a/koha-tmpl/intranet-tmpl/prog/en/modules/circ/renew.tt b/koha-tmpl/intranet-tmpl/prog/en/modules/circ/renew.tt >index fe090b5..32d9f58 100644 >--- a/koha-tmpl/intranet-tmpl/prog/en/modules/circ/renew.tt >+++ b/koha-tmpl/intranet-tmpl/prog/en/modules/circ/renew.tt >@@ -1,6 +1,5 @@ > [% USE Koha %] > [% USE KohaDates %] >-[% USE KohaBranchName %] > > [% INCLUDE 'doc-head-open.inc' %] > >@@ -30,11 +29,11 @@ > > [% ELSIF error == "no_checkout" %] > >- <p><a href="/cgi-bin/koha/catalogue/detail.pl?biblionumber=[% item.biblionumber %]">[% item.biblio.title %] [% item.biblioitem.subtitle %]</a> ( <a href="/cgi-bin/koha/catalogue/moredetail.pl?itemnumber=[% item.itemnumber %]&biblionumber=[% item.biblionumber %]&bi=[% item.biblioitemnumber %]#item[% item.itemnumber %]">[% item.barcode %]</a> ) is not checked out to a patron.</p> >+ <p><a href="/cgi-bin/koha/catalogue/detail.pl?biblionumber=[% item.biblionumber %]">[% Koha.Encode( item.biblio.title ) %] [% Koha.Encode( item.biblioitem.subtitle ) %]</a> ( <a href="/cgi-bin/koha/catalogue/moredetail.pl?itemnumber=[% item.itemnumber %]&biblionumber=[% item.biblionumber %]&bi=[% item.biblioitemnumber %]#item[% item.itemnumber %]">[% item.barcode %]</a> ) is not checked out to a patron.</p> > > [% ELSIF error == "too_many" %] > >- <p>[% item.biblio.title %] [% item.biblioitem.subtitle %] ( [% item.barcode %] ) has been renewed the maximum number of times by [% borrower.firstname %] [% borrower.surname %] ( <a href="/cgi-bin/koha/members/moremember.pl?borrowernumber=[% borrower.borrowernumber %]"> [% borrower.cardnumber %] </a> )</p> >+ <p>[% Koha.Encode( item.biblio.title ) %] [% Koha.Encode( item.biblioitem.subtitle ) %] ( [% item.barcode %] ) has been renewed the maximum number of times by [% borrower.firstname %] [% borrower.surname %] ( <a href="/cgi-bin/koha/members/moremember.pl?borrowernumber=[% borrower.borrowernumber %]"> [% borrower.cardnumber %] </a> )</p> > > [% IF Koha.Preference('AllowRenewalLimitOverride') %] > <form method="post" action="/cgi-bin/koha/circ/renew.pl"> >@@ -75,7 +74,7 @@ > <div class="dialog message"> > <h3>Item renewed:</h3> > <p> >- <a href="/cgi-bin/koha/catalogue/detail.pl?biblionumber=[% item.biblionumber %]">[% item.biblio.title %] [% item.biblioitem.subtitle %]</a> >+ <a href="/cgi-bin/koha/catalogue/detail.pl?biblionumber=[% item.biblionumber %]">[% Koha.Encode( item.biblio.title ) %] [% Koha.Encode( item.biblioitem.subtitle ) %]</a> > ( <a href="/cgi-bin/koha/catalogue/moredetail.pl?itemnumber=[% item.itemnumber %]&biblionumber=[% item.biblionumber %]&bi=[% item.biblioitemnumber %]#item[% item.itemnumber %]">[% item.barcode %]</a> ) > renewed for > [% borrower.firstname %] [% borrower.surname %] ( <a href="/cgi-bin/koha/members/moremember.pl?borrowernumber=[% borrower.borrowernumber %]"> [% borrower.cardnumber %] </a> ) >-- >1.7.2.5
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
|
Splinter Review
Attachments on
bug 10493
:
19155
|
20044
|
20049
|
20050
|
20143
|
22076
|
22077
|
22139
|
22180
|
22192
|
22194
|
22196
|
22197
|
22199
|
22200
|
22202
|
22203
|
22241
|
22242
|
22243